Download NowNEW DELHI: The Directorate of Government Examinations, Tamil Nadu will publish the TN 12th supplementary public exam time table 2025 tomorrow, May 9, on the official website, dge.tn.gov.in. Students who failed to pass in the TN 12th result 2025 will be able to apply for Tamil Nadu Class 12 supplementary exams 2025 from May 16. TN 12th Result 2025 (OUT) LIVE
The TN Class 12th statement of marks will be uploaded on May 12. Students will be able to download it directly from the DGE TN official website. Moreover, they will be able to apply for the scanned copy of TN HSE answer sheets from May 13 to May 17.
Although the pass percentage improves for all schools, private schools continue to outperform government schools in Tamil Nadu.
The Tamil Nadu education minister Anbil Mahesh announced that the state board will conduct the TN Class 12th supplementary exams from May 15. Students will have to apply for the Tamil Nadu supplementary exams through their respective school. “The second chance to improve and clear the higher secondary exam is given to reduce the drop rate,” the minister said.
Tamil Nadu 12th result 2025 slightly improves
Students who have scored 35 marks out of 100 have been declared pass in TN 12th result 2025 . The overall pass percentage of the last 5 years is given below.
|
Year |
Number of students passed |
Overall pass percentage |
Boys pass percentage |
Girls pass percentage |
|
2025 |
7,53,142 |
95.03% |
93.16% |
96.7% |
|
2024 |
7,19,196 |
94.56% |
92.37% |
96.44% |
|
2023 |
7,55,451 |
94.03% |
91.45% |
96.38% |
|
2022 |
7,55,998 |
93.76% |
90.96% |
96.32% |
|
2021 |
8,16,473 |
100% |
100% |
100% |
|
2019 |
7,69,225 |
91.3% |
88.6% |
93.6% |
